Main duties of the job
The main purpose of this role is to perform general pharmaceutical duties under the supervision of the Dispensary Manager (or nominated supervisor), in line with current policies and procedures.
* Receive, dispense, hand out prescriptions, and provide other support services to the Pharmacy department, including the receipt of orders and the supply of medicines to wards and departments.
* Support the pharmacy purchasing and distribution service.
* Carry out basic pharmacy duties and assist in the provision of a high-quality, patient-oriented service.
* Support and contribute to pharmacy audit and effectiveness activities across the trust.
* Provide an efficient administration service within the Pharmacy department.
